How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Jefferson?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Jefferson Studio Apartments | $873 | $795 | $899 |
Jefferson 1 Bedroom Apartments | $955 | $575 | $1,875 |
Jefferson 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,073 | $635 | $2,200 |
Jefferson 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,577 | $830 | $2,025 |
Jefferson 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,687 | $1,500 | $1,900 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Jefferson
How much are Studio apartments in Jefferson?
There are currently 5 Studio Apartments in Jefferson with rent ranges from $795 to $899 with an average price of $873.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Jefferson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Jefferson ranges from $575 to $1,875 with an average monthly rent of $955.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Jefferson c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Jefferson range from $635 to $2,200.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,073.
How expensive are Jefferson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 18 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Jefferson on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$830 to $2,025 - averaging $1,577 for the location.
